Om 'n bestaande MySQL-databasis na Wolk SQL te migreer met behulp van die Wolkkonsole, moet jy 'n reeks stappe volg wat 'n gladde en doeltreffende migrasieproses verseker. Cloud SQL is 'n volledig bestuurde relasionele databasisdiens wat deur Google Cloud Platform (GCP) verskaf word wat dit maklik maak om MySQL-databasisse in die wolk op te stel, te bestuur en te skaal. Deur jou databasis na Cloud SQL te migreer, kan jy voordeel trek uit die voordele wat GCP bied, soos skaalbaarheid, hoë beskikbaarheid en outomatiese rugsteun.
Hier is 'n gedetailleerde verduideliking van hoe om 'n bestaande MySQL-databasis na Wolk SQL te migreer met behulp van die Wolkkonsole:
1. Stel 'n Cloud SQL-instansie op: Eerstens moet jy 'n Cloud SQL-instansie in die gewenste projek en streek skep. Dit kan gedoen word met behulp van die Wolkkonsole. Tydens die skepping van die instansie sal jy die instansietipe, bergingskapasiteit en ander konfigurasieopsies moet spesifiseer. Maak seker dat jy die toepaslike instansiegrootte kies op grond van jou werkladingsvereistes.
2. Berei die MySQL-databasis voor vir migrasie: Voordat jy die databasis migreer, moet jy verseker dat dit in 'n konsekwente toestand is en gereed is vir migrasie. Dit behels die neem van 'n rugsteun van die databasis, die deaktivering van enige deurlopende prosesse wat die data kan verander, en om te verseker dat die databasisskema versoenbaar is met Cloud SQL. U kan gereedskap soos mysqldump gebruik om 'n rugsteun van die databasis te skep.
3. Skep 'n Wolkberging-emmer: Wolkberging word gebruik om die rugsteunlêer wat in Cloud SQL ingevoer sal word, te stoor. Skep 'n nuwe emmer in die gewenste streek met behulp van die Wolkkonsole. Maak seker dat jy die nodige toestemmings aan die Cloud SQL-diensrekening verleen om toegang tot die emmer te kry.
4. Laai die rugsteunlêer op na Wolkberging: Sodra die emmer geskep is, laai die rugsteunlêer van die MySQL-databasis op na die emmer. Dit kan gedoen word met behulp van die Cloud Console of opdragreëlnutsgoed soos gsutil. Maak seker dat jy die pad van die rugsteunlêer in Cloud Storage aanteken, aangesien dit tydens die invoerproses vereis sal word.
5. Voer die databasis in Cloud SQL in: Gaan nou na die Cloud SQL-instansiebladsy in die Cloud Console en kies die instansie wat jy vroeër geskep het. Klik op die "Import"-knoppie om die invoerproses te begin. Kies die rugsteunlêer van Cloud Storage wat jy in die vorige stap opgelaai het. Spesifiseer die databasisnaam, gebruiker en wagwoord vir die ingevoerde databasis. Jy kan ook bykomende opsies kies, soos om 'n ander bergingsenjin te spesifiseer of slegs spesifieke tabelle in te voer. Sodra die invoerproses begin is, sal Cloud SQL 'n nuwe databasis met die gespesifiseerde naam skep en die data vanaf die rugsteunlêer invoer.
6. Verifieer die migrasie: Nadat die invoerproses voltooi is, moet jy die migrasie verifieer deur aan die Cloud SQL-instansie te koppel en te kyk of die data ongeskonde is. U kan gereedskap soos die Cloud SQL Proxy of die MySQL-opdragreëlnutsding gebruik om aan die instansie te koppel en navrae teen die ingevoerde databasis uit te voer.
7. Dateer toepassingkonfigurasies op: Sodra die migrasie suksesvol is, moet jy die konfigurasie van jou toepassings opdateer om na die nuwe Cloud SQL-instansie te wys. Dit behels die verandering van die verbindingstring of konfigurasielêers om die Cloud SQL-instansie se verbindingbesonderhede te gebruik, soos die instansienaam, gebruikersnaam, wagwoord en databasisnaam.
Deur hierdie stappe te volg, kan jy 'n bestaande MySQL-databasis migreer na Wolk SQL met behulp van die Wolkkonsole. Hierdie proses verseker dat u data veilig na die wolk oorgedra word en dat u toepassings moeiteloos aan die nuwe databasis-instansie kan koppel.
Ander onlangse vrae en antwoorde t.o.v Wolk SQL:
- Wat is die sekuriteitsmaatreëls wat Cloud SQL tref om data-enkripsie en -beskerming te verseker?
- Wat is die opsies beskikbaar vir outomatiese rugsteun en herstel in Cloud SQL?
- Hoe kan jy 'n Cloud SQL-instansie in GCP opstel?
- Wat is die belangrikste voordele van die gebruik van Cloud SQL in Google Cloud Platform (GCP)?